This is an AS Chemistry lesson on constructing Born Haber cycles in order to calculate lattice enthalpy for ionic compounds. Students do not calculate lattice enthalpies in this lesson but rather consider using a diamond nine how various factors affect how exothermic the lattice enthalpy value is.
